The Commissioner for Human Rights (Ombudsman) Responds to the Arrest of Piotr Niemczyk. An Appeal Is Pending.

Summary by TVN24.pl
Human Rights Ombudsman Sylwia Gregorczyk-Abram has filed a cassation appeal with the Supreme Court in Piotr Niemczyk's case. She requests that the verdict be overturned and his acquittal be declared.

On Tuesday, Piotr Niemczyk, a former opposition activist from the Polish People's Republic, was arrested. He was sentenced along with 26 others under a mandatory court order for participating in the Last Generation protest. This group of activists wanted to draw attention to the "effects of climate collapse" by, among other things, attempting to block streets and bridges. In May 2025, according to media reports, they blocked one of the capital's…

The District Court for Warsaw-Śródmieście has suspended the execution of the sentence against former opposition activist Piotr Niemczyk, his attorney, Jacek Dubois, announced. Meanwhile, Ombudsman Sylwia Gregorczyk-Abram has filed a cassation appeal with the Supreme Court regarding Niemczyk. "I have a strong grievance against the police," the former deputy head of the Intelligence Directorate of the State Protection Office told TOK FM.

"In the case of Piotr Niemczyk, the court has suspended the execution of the sentence," said the man's attorney, Jacek Dubois. A former opposition activist and intelligence officer.

Piotr Niemczyk, a well-known opposition figure from the communist era, was arrested on Tuesday for his participation in the Last Generation protest in Warsaw. His arrest sparked considerable outrage and led, among other things, to an intervention by the Human Rights Ombudsman. A court has now decided Niemczyk's fate.

"The court has just suspended the execution of the sentence in Piotr Niemczyk's case," attorney Jacek Dubois reported. Shortly thereafter, Waldemar Żurek announced that "he has just been released from prison."
